The Devils and Kings put on a back-and-forth thriller that kept fans on edge, with the Devils ultimately taking a 6-4 win. From the first drop of the puck, both teams showcased their speed, skill, and physical play.


First Period: Devils Strike Early

The Devils came out firing with Cody Glass scoring the opening goal on a clean wrist shot, assisted by Arseny Gritsyuk. The Kings pushed, but couldn't capitalize. Nico Hischier added a second for the Devils, assisted by Timo Meier and Luke Hughes.


Both goalies, Jake Allen (Devils) and Anton Forsberg (Kings), made key stops, keeping the game competitive. By the end of the first period, the Devils led 2-0, showing early dominance and setting the energy.
